How to Potty Train a Toddler: Potty Train Your Child without the Stress

Toilet training your child can seem like a daunting task. It brings fear to the minds of many parents. It’s almost as bad as teaching your child to drive; but not quite.

The main thing to remember before you start potty training is that your child will succeed. Maybe not in your time-line or as quickly as you’d prefer; but they will learn. You will not be sending your child to high school in diapers. This is just one step in a long line of things your child will master as they grow up
